Lugo Company manufactures drinking glasses. One unit is a package of eight glasses, which sells for $10. Lugo projects sales for April will be 2,000 packages, with sales increasing by 350 packages per month for May, June and July. On April 1. Lugo has 150 packages on hand but desires to maintain an ending inventory of 10% of the next month's sales. Prepare a sales budget and a production budget for Lugo for April, May, and June. Begin by preparing a sales budget for April, May, and June.
